PDC bits are specially designed for fast drilling in shale, limestone, and sandstone formations. They come in two types of bodies: steel body and matrix body. Both types offer the same cutting effectiveness. strickly speak, the matrix body material is more hard than steel body but the strength is not so well comparably with steel body .  Each of the body have their own advantage : 

The performance of the drill bit is influenced by several factors:

Body material: This refers to the material used to construct the bit's body.
Cutter density: It refers to how the cutting elements are arranged and their quantity on the bit.
Cutter size or type: This describes the size or type of the cutting elements on the bit.
Bit profile: It determines the shape and design of the bit's cutting structure.

PDC Drill Bit 'S Cutters
The primary contact point of a drill bit is its PDC cutters, which are made of Polycrystalline Diamond Composite (PDC). PDC bits excel at efficiently removing rock by chopping through it.

Operating in a challenging environment, PDC cutters experience frequent heating and cooling within the well. To maximize performance, PDC cutters with superior thermal stability and minimal thermal deterioration are preferred. These optimized cutters demonstrate higher Rate of Penetration (ROP) and enhanced wear resistance.
.
PDC Drill Bit'S  Nozzles
Drill bit nozzles play a crucial role in maintaining the temperature of the PDC cutters and clearing the cutting zone. By keeping the PDC cutters cool, the nozzles contribute to their longevity and performance.

The positioning and angle of these nozzles significantly influence the effectiveness of the drill bit. Properly placed nozzles ensure efficient cooling and help prevent heat-related issues. Additionally, the strategic arrangement of fluid channels, in conjunction with the nozzle location, facilitates improved removal of cuttings during drilling operations.

Steel Body PDC Bits
The antithesis of a matrix body is a steel body. Although it is softer and lacking protective features, it is capable of withstanding severe impact loads. Steel bit bodies provide a high level of impact resistance due to the strength and ductility of steel.
Matrix bodies are significantly weaker than steel bodies.
Steel bits have the advantage of being easily rebuilt multiple times due to the ease with which worn or damaged cutters can be swapped out. Operators who operate in low-cost drilling environments will particularly benefit from this.
In contrast to roller cones, polycrystalline diamond compact (PDC) drill bits have a single, non-moving body. In consolidated formations, the bit can operate at faster rotation rates because the fixed-cutters efficiently shred the rock.

Drill Bit PDC Cutters
It's crucial to first recognize the significance of Polycrystalline Diamond Compact (PDC) Cutters.
PDC Cutters improve the functionality of PDC drill bits by increasing their dynamic stability in a variety of difficult vertical and directional drilling applications.

One-of-a-kind polycrystalline diamond cutter has exceptional strength, hardness, and toughness.

It is therefore perfect for a variety of material removal (cutting) procedures.

PDCs are produced utilizing tungsten carbide, diamond, high pressure, and heat.

Why choose PDC Drill Bit
PDC bits have the fixed blades with large, hard, abrasion-resistant cutters manufactured from a boned mass of microcrystalline synthetic diamonds and designed to excavate hole by shearing the formation while tricone insert bit works by crushing it.

Softer the formation and homogenous smaller the number of blades and bigger the size of the PDC cutters.

They drill very fast in soft to moderately hard formations as Sand, Shale, Clay and Siltstone.
